Is Pennsylvania Bluestone a better choice than wood for a new patio?

For longevity and low maintenance, Pennsylvania Bluestone is superior. It is a durable natural stone that won't rot, warp, or require chemical treatments like wood. From a Firewise perspective, its non-combustible nature contributes to defensible space in this low-risk urban interface zone, unlike wood decks or mulch beds which are combustible fuels.

I'm tired of weekly mowing. Are there lower-maintenance, eco-friendly alternatives to grass?

Transitioning high-input turf to a native plant meadow is a forward-thinking solution. Species like Switchgrass, Purple Coneflower, and Wild Bergamot are adapted to our Zone 7b climate and require no mowing, minimal water, and no phosphorus fertilizer. This biodiversity-rich landscape also future-proofs your property against tightening noise ordinances restricting gas-powered blowers and mowers.

I see Japanese Stiltgrass and Garlic Mustard invading my garden. How do I treat them safely?

Those are significant invasive species alerts. Manual removal before seed set is most effective. For persistent issues, targeted, EPA-approved herbicides can be applied by licensed professionals, strictly following label instructions. Critically, any treatment must comply with the Philadelphia Water Department Stormwater Regulations, which prohibit phosphorus application on established turf and have specific blackout dates for other chemicals to protect watersheds.

My yard pools water after rain. Is this a common issue here, and what's the solution?

Moderate runoff is prevalent in Chestnut Hill due to the clay-heavy subsoil beneath the Wissahickon loam, which restricts percolation. Solutions include installing French drains or dry creek beds to direct water. For patios or walkways, specifying permeable set Pennsylvania Bluestone allows stormwater to infiltrate, meeting Philadelphia Department of Licenses and Inspections standards for managing on-site runoff.

My lawn struggles despite feeding it. Could my property's age affect the soil?

Properties in Chestnut Hill, built around 1988, have soils that are now 38 years post-construction. The native Wissahickon Schist-derived loam was likely compacted and stripped of topsoil during the building process. This results in a shallow, dense layer with poor permeability and depleted organic matter, explaining poor turf performance. Core aeration and incorporating 2-3 inches of compost are essential to rebuild soil structure and biology.

How can I keep my Tall Fescue blend green without violating water conservation guidelines?

Under Philadelphia's voluntary conservation status, smart irrigation is key. Wi-Fi ET-based controllers adjust watering schedules daily using local evapotranspiration data, preventing overwatering. For Wissahickon loam, this means deeper, less frequent cycles that encourage drought-tolerant root growth in your turf blend. This system typically reduces water use by 20-30% while maintaining plant health within municipal limits.
